#05bb84 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#05bb84 is composed of 2% red, 73.3% green and 51.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 97.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 29.4% yellow and 26.7% black. It has a hue angle of 161.9 degrees, a saturation of 94.8% and a lightness of 37.6%. #05bb84 color hex could be obtained by blending #0affff with #007709. Closest websafe color is: #00cc99.

#05bb84 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#05bb84 has RGB values of R:5, G:187, B:132 and CMYK values of C:0.97, M:0, Y:0.29,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 375684.

Hex triplet 05bb84 #05bb84
RGB Decimal 5, 187, 132 rgb(5,187,132)
RGB Percent 2, 73.3, 51.8 rgb(2%,73.3%,51.8%)
CMYK 97, 0, 29, 27
HSL 161.9°, 94.8, 37.6 hsl(161.9,94.8%,37.6%)
HSV (or HSB) 161.9°, 97.3, 73.3
Web Safe 00cc99 #00cc99
CIE-LAB 67.454, -52.74, 16.921
XYZ 21.996, 37.236, 27.857
xyY 0.253, 0.428, 37.236
CIE-LCH 67.454, 55.388, 162.212
CIE-LUV 67.454, -57.312, 31.822
Hunter-Lab 61.022, -42.446, 15.649
Binary 00000101, 10111011, 10000100

Shades and Tints of #05bb84

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000f0b is the darkest color, while #fbfff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#05bb84

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5e6261 is the less saturated color, while #05bb84 is the most saturated one.
